A cream cheese pound cake studded with dried cranberries and pecans, subtly spiced and topped with praline frosting. A festive, rich dessert perfect for the holidays.

Ingredients

serves 10
  • 1 cup dried cranberries
  • 3 cups cake flour
  • 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½ teaspoon ground ginger
  • 1½ cups unsalted butter (at room temperature)
  • 8 ounces cream cheese (at room temperature)
  • 3 cups granulated sugar
  • 6 eggs (at room temperature)
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up chopped pecans
  • ½ cup light brown sugar
  • ¼ cup unsalted butter
  • 3 tablespoons whole mil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
